Fasudil Protects Against Diclofenac-Induced Hepatorenal and Gastric Injury via Modulation of ROCK/TLR4/SIRT1 Signaling and Preservation of Tight Junctions.

摘要

Diclofenac is a widely consumed non-steroidal anti-inflammatory drug, yet its clinical utility is limited by severe hepatotoxicity, acute kidney injury, and gastric ulceration. While the RhoA/ROCK pathway is implicated in inflammation, its potential as a therapeutic target for multi-organ NSAID toxicity remains unexplored. This study evaluated the dose-dependent protective effects of the ROCK inhibitor, fasudil, against diclofenac-induced damage and investigated the underlying ROCK2/TLR4/SIRT1 axis. Five separate cohorts were established using thirty male Sprague-Dawley rats. Alongside a normal control and fasudil control group, one experimental group was treated with 100 mg/kg diclofenac. Furthermore, two distinct groups were pretreated with fasudil for seven days before induction, receiving either a 10 mg/kg or a 30 mg/kg dose prior to diclofenac administration. Diclofenac provoked severe hepatic, renal, and gastric injury accompanied by marked oxidative stress. Pretreatment with fasudil markedly reversed these effects and improved hepatic and renal function biomarkers. Mechanistically, fasudil reduced renal and hepatic ROCK2 and TLR4 expression, which consequently suppressed downstream systemic inflammatory markers, including NF-κB and TNF-α. Furthermore, fasudil halted apoptosis by restoring SIRT1 expression and reducing cleaved caspase-3, alongside preserving gastric barrier integrity. Fasudil dose-dependently ameliorates diclofenac-induced hepatic, renal, and gastric injury by silencing the ROCK2/TLR4 inflammatory axis, restoring SIRT1 survival networks, and protecting epithelial tight junctions.
